The Royal Australian Naval College (RANC), commonly known as HMAS Creswell, is the naval academy of the Royal Australian Navy (RAN). HMAS Creswell is a shore establishment of the Royal Australian Navy, a part of the Australian Defence Force, and consists of the Royal Australian Naval College (RANC), the RAN School of Survivability and Ship's Safety, Kalkara Flight, the Beecroft Weapons Range and an administrative support department. Phase 1 covers weeks 1 to 4 (internal at Recruit School), Phase 2 covers weeks 5 to 9 (external to Recruit School) and Phase 3 covers weeks 10 and 11 (internal at Recruit School).
